Welcome to the Yedid – Alumni Association

 

Yedid - Moriah's Alumni Association - was formed in 1999 as a means for old Collegians to re-connect with the College, their friends and classmates; however class reunions themselves have been staged for over 20 years.
 

The Hebrew word 'Yedid' means a friend with whom you were once close but may have lost contact - someone like a school friend.
